I'm 6'3" and a little under 13 stone. The SV is absolutely no problem, I can slide forwards and backwards on the seat (rather than feeling like I should sit on the pillion seat as I did on the cg125 ). It doesn't feel too low, nor do the pegs seem too high, the bars on my S are not even uncomfortably low, the nekkid one will be no problem, I couldn't be happier. I imagine if you bump up the preload a notch or two it will be spot on
